What if the secret to spiritual strength isn't moving faster but growing deeper? Today we explore a powerful truth from Jeremiah 17 that challenges our culture's obsession with speed and productivity.

"Be rooted, not rushed" serves as both our theme and our challenge as we examine the prophet's vivid imagery of trees planted along riverbanks. These aren't just any trees—they're symbols of believers whose trust in God allows them to develop systems of spiritual nourishment that sustain them through every season. Just as trees don't grow tall by hurrying but by establishing deep, unseen roots, our spiritual lives flourish not through religious busyness but through unhurried connection with God.

We unpack this counter-cultural wisdom by exploring what it means to develop spiritual roots through consistent prayer, thoughtful engagement with Scripture, and deliberate trust in God's timeline rather than our own. The meditation culminates in a practical challenge: spend 15 minutes today in Scripture, focusing on quality rather than quantity. This simple practice represents the kind of intentional, unhurried spiritual discipline that transforms us from the inside out. Be rooted, not rushed.
From Jeremiah, chapter 17,verses 7 and 8.
From the New Living TranslationBlessed are those who trust in
the Lord and have made the Lordtheir hope and confidence.
They are like trees plantedalong a riverbank, with roots
that reach deep into the water.

(00:45):
Trees don't grow tall byrushing.
They grow strong by beingrooted.
Jeremiah shows us a picture ofa person who trusts God, deeply
rooted, nourished by hispresence, unshaken by drought or
storms.

(01:06):
Spiritual roots take time.
They're built through prayer,through God's word, through
choosing to trust him when youcan't see the outcome, don't
rush the process.
Let your roots grow deep.
Today, spend at least 15minutes reading scripture.

(01:27):
Yeah, no rushing, just do it.
Highlight or underline onephrase that speaks to you and
meditate on it throughout theday.
